A dust collection system produces nothing. It shortens no cycle and adds no value to the part.
That is why the classic payback calculation does not work. What you calculate is what it prevents.
What it prevents
Shutdown. Without compliant dust capture, operations can be suspended. This is the cost nobody budgets and the one that dwarfs the rest.
Operator illness. Respirable dust causes irreversible occupational disease. The cost is paid in compensation, in absence, and in people lost.
Wear on everything else. Airborne abrasive dust gets into bearings, guideways and electrical cabinets across the hall. It shortens the life of everything around it.
Cleaning. Dust that is not captured settles and has to be swept. That is labour, every shift.
Abrasive loss. In a poorly balanced system, extraction pulls good abrasive along with the dust. This is a direct, measurable cost and the easiest one to ignore.
Surface quality. Dust settling back on clean parts compromises the next operation, painting in particular.
What gets sized
Filtration is not bought “by power”. It is sized on the air volume required to maintain correct velocities at the enclosure openings.
That volume follows from the geometry: opening area, enclosure type and required inward velocity. A machine with large openings needs high volume, no matter how small the part.
Undersizing does not show at commissioning. It shows in the dust escaping around the doors and in filters clogging too soon.
Running cost
Filters — cartridges or bags, with replacement intervals that depend on actual loading.
Fan energy — running whenever blasting runs.
Compressed air for filter cleaning, on self-cleaning systems.
Disposal of the collected dust, as waste.
The question to ask when quoting
Not “what does the filter cost”, but: what air volume do I need for my installation, and what velocities does that give at the openings?
A supplier who answers the second question has understood the problem. One who answers only the first is selling a machine, not a solution.
